评估直肠癌放射治疗中的轴特定设置错误:基于形束计算机断层扫描的前性研究与身体质量指数相关性

概括
对直肠癌的精确放射治疗需要特定的规划目标体积 (PTV) 边缘,由每日图像指导提供信息. 体重指数 (BMI) 可以影响设置的准确性,需要个性化的方法.

背景情况:
- 图像指导放射治疗 (IGRT) 对于精确瘤向至关重要.
- 准确的患者定位至关重要,以尽量减少对健康组织的辐射剂量.
- 了解设置错误是优化治疗利率的关键.
研究的目的:
- 在接受放射治疗的直肠癌患者中量化设置错误.
- 为了获得最佳的临床目标体积 (CTV) 规划目标体积 (PTV) 利.
- 为了评估身体质量指数 (BMI) 对设置准确性的影响.
主要方法:
- 分析了来自41名直肠癌患者的1102次每日形光束计算机断层扫描 (CBCT) 扫描.
- 测量中侧 (X),尾 (Y) 和前后 (Z) 的转移移位.
- 计算系统 (Σ) 和随机 (σ) 错误,使用范赫克公式来推导PTV保证金.
主要成果:
- 在所有轴 (X:0.04毫米,Y:0.57毫米,Z:0.13毫米) 中观察到的低平均系统设置错误.
- 衍生的PTV利率为7.4毫米 (X),9.1毫米 (Y) 和9.7毫米 (Z).
- 在BMI和Z轴设置错误 (r=0.55,P=0.002) 之间发现了显著的正相关性,其中23.1%的分数需要>5毫米的校正.
结论:
- 由于解剖学变异性,直肠癌放射治疗需要轴特定的PTV边缘.
- 每日CBCT显著提高了设置精度和治疗准确度.
- 建议对BMI等因素进行个性化规划,以获得最佳结果.
